首页 > 栏目 > 冒泡排序基本过程

冒泡排序基本过程

冒泡排序是排序算法中的一种简单且经典的算法。它的基本思路是通过不断地交换相邻元素的位置来达到排序的目的。下面我们来详细了解一下冒泡排序的基本过程。

首先,冒泡排序是一种比较排序算法,它的排序过程是从左到右,依次比较相邻的两个元素的大小,如果前面的元素大于后面的元素,就交换它们的位置,这样每一轮比较后,最大的元素就会“冒泡”到序列的末尾。这就是为什么这种排序算法被称为“冒泡排序”。

具体来说,假设我们要将一个长度为n的序列按从小到大排序,那么冒泡排序的基本步骤如下:

1. 从序列的第一个元素开始,依次比较相邻的两个元素的大小,如果前面的元素大于后面的元素,就交换它们的位置。

2. 继续比较下一对相邻的元素,直到将整个序列中的所有相邻元素都比较完毕。

3. 重复执行步骤1和步骤2,直到没有任何一对相邻元素需要交换位置。

这样,我们就可以将一个无序的序列按从小到大排序。当然,在实际应用中,我们还需要考虑一些特殊情况,比如序列中有相同元素的情况,或者序列已经是有序的情况等等。

总之,冒泡排序虽然是一种简单的排序算法,但是它的基本原理和思想却是很重要的,它可以帮助我们更好地理解排序算法的基本过程和思路。

高速下载

热门音效 更多>

随机推荐 更多>